>> The power delivered to the load really is forward power minus reverse
>> power.  You can see that by imagining that you disconnect the load
>> completely (infinite impedance) or short it out (zero impedance).  That
>> means no power can be absorbed by the load.
>>
>> The wattmeter reads equal forward and reverse power, so that forward minus
>> reverse equals zero, as it must.
